rectangularly

/rɛkˈtæŋɡjələrli/
adverb
  1. In a way that forms or relates to a rectangle; with right angles and straight sides.
    • She folded the paper rectangularly so it would fit perfectly into the envelope.
    • The tiles were arranged rectangularly, creating a neat grid pattern on the floor.
    • The city blocks were laid out rectangularly, making navigation easy.
